作为一名程序员,我们经常需要在项目中实现页面的动态刷新效果。而JSP(Java Server Pages)作为一种强大的服务器端技术,可以轻松地帮助我们实现这一功能。本文将为大家详细介绍如何使用JSP实现页面刷新,并通过一个实例教程来展示其具体应用。
1. JSP页面刷新简介
JSP页面刷新主要是指在一定时间间隔内,自动刷新页面内容,使用户能够实时获取最新的数据。这通常在显示实时数据、股票行情、在线聊天等场景中非常有用。
2. JSP页面刷新原理
JSP页面刷新主要通过以下两种方式实现:
1. 使用标签:通过设置标签的http-equiv属性为“refresh”,并指定刷新时间(单位为秒),可以实现页面刷新。
2. 使用JavaScript定时器:通过JavaScript中的setInterval函数,可以设置定时器,定时刷新页面。
3. JSP页面刷新实例教程
下面,我们将通过一个简单的实例教程,展示如何使用JSP实现页面刷新。
3.1 创建项目
我们需要创建一个JSP项目。这里以Eclipse为例,具体操作如下:
1. 打开Eclipse,选择“File” -> “New” -> “Java Project”,命名为“PageRefreshExample”。
2. 在弹出的窗口中,点击“Finish”按钮。
3.2 创建JSP页面
接下来,我们需要创建一个JSP页面,用于展示刷新效果。在项目目录下,右键点击“src”文件夹,选择“New” -> “JSP File”,命名为“refresh.jsp”。
3.3 编写JSP代码
在“refresh.jsp”页面中,我们将使用标签实现页面刷新。以下是具体的代码示例:
```jsp
<%@ page language="

